Tammy Swearingen is currently the assistant athletic director along with being the head volleyball coach. She remembers coming to Westminster and having to deal with Title IX issues as a coach. She also remembers a situation in high school when the junior varsity boys team was given priority in the gym over the varsity girls team. Title IX was established at the time, but not strictly enforced. Swearingen then preceded to the athletic director’s office because of the Title IX violation. She says from that situation they started to take Title IX seriously. Swearingen goes on to say, "we are not just girls anymore; we are the varsity team so we get to use the big gym that we play our games in." Other than that, Swearingen hasn't dealt with too many problems dealing with Title IX.
